Whats wrong with the course setup... Specifically??? I praise the three
course setup... I only see three problems that could exsist.. Which arent
really problems rather then a work in progress.
1st. According to the map of the courses the timing slip pickup for your
speeds is located between the 6 and 7 mile marker for combination #1 Course.
That means for a short course or long course vehicle that only may run the
combination course thru the 3 or 4 and pulls off course asap. May have to
load the race vehicle then travel down to the 6 1/2 to get your timing
ticket. Then back down to impound.
2nd. For the spectators for the event there wont be much to see after the
pits. Again the end of the pits shows 6 mile on course, so for spectators
wont be much of a show down there.
3rd. If the combination course 2 is used for a long course vehicle
(streamliner type, that also loads onto a trailer or pushes back at rather
low rate of speed). I could see the 1 hour timetable to get to impound may
be an issue for some teams. Timing starts when you exit the last or first
timed mile? So now your tow rig how to go down 7-8 miles for pickup, then
load then back 7-8 more miles, go around the pre-stage area which will be a
very slow area, I see that could be a rather large turnaround, then back
another 3 miles to impound area. Using posted speed limits, one stop at
timing slips, and pushing rather slow back, and having short reception at
end when crew shows up, then loading the car.. I come up with 58 minutes...
And there is some safety margin in there. And that was assuming 50 mph down,
30 mph back, 10 mph around prestage area, 30 mph to impound area, and 15
minute reception and load time to prepare vehicle for push or tow back, 2-3
minute time slip pickup.

Would like to hear how fast (MPH) people tow back, in both a trailer loaded
vehicle, and a push type vehicle. I have seen some push back fast and some
very slow, I guess it just depends on vehicle.
